Brunwick Place : A Brief Property Acquisition History
  In 1982, the triangular building at North 10th and A (now known as 101 North 10th) was
acquired from the Electrical Workers Union, hence the current property owners name of
Union Hall Investment Company. We hired a local contractor specializing in historical
renovations, Phil White, who helped us design the combination of residential
and commercial spaces. During this period, we also acquired the building
at 917 North A Street, which has been renovated and now
operates as an entertainment club venue.
In 1983 we acquired the church building and adjacent
parking lot at the corner of North 10th and B. Shortly
after, the balance of the block at the B St. end was
acquired.  This became 115 North 10th. Thereafter,
we petitioned the City to close Short Grand &
Short Towson Streets.  Those properties then
became our streets facilitating additional
parking for our tenants and business guests.
A few years ago, we added the Tower TV
property and parking lot to our holdings.
The only property on the entire block that we
don't own is the SW corner of North 9th and A.
